Transaction 31f3ed0ad2e60c5d294f6d170d30c7a5840586642b5103985b2ff34547d6dce4

1 Input
2 Outputs
  • 31f3ed0ad2e60c5d294f6d170d30c7a5840586642b5103985b2ff34547d6dce4:0
  • value  1923375620
    address  1KEtzcMWEW4AjRX6XvpwDcXYgFaDMqqHaV
  • 31f3ed0ad2e60c5d294f6d170d30c7a5840586642b5103985b2ff34547d6dce4:1
  • value  1009372
    address  3DT2dtnwNiBKrg5D2zFjHnuyB7TRKMPVyg